Output 8584bb375936af66c1d221de5ebff6cb55df0667e9fe2acdb6031d1be7388398:52

value
185601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d3fbb6f630a0dd23605b6386aef4a0051426e29 OP_EQUAL
address
32u54E5KiTPjh3d8KUGAQyyJt9u2UqeKgS
transaction
8584bb375936af66c1d221de5ebff6cb55df0667e9fe2acdb6031d1be7388398